The Sleep Foundation: Rest, Recovery, and Cognitive Readiness
Quality sleep is the bedrock of motivation and mental energy. When sleep is insufficient or fragmented, mood becomes volatile, decision making grows cautious or impulsive, and the capacity to sustain effort diminishes. A well rested brain processes new information more efficiently, maintains better attention, and recovers faster after stress. Establishing regular sleep patterns helps synchronize the body’s internal clock, which in turn stabilizes energy levels across the day. This does not require heroic overnight changes; small, consistent adjustments to bedtimes, pre sleep routines, and bedroom environments can yield meaningful improvements over weeks. The goal is to cultivate a rhythm that allows for complete cycles of rest and awakening, which provides a stable platform from which motivation can rise and energy can be allocated where it matters most.
One practical approach is to limit stimulating stimuli in the hours leading up to sleep. Dimming lights, reducing screen exposure, and engaging in calm, low intensity activities can help the brain transition from wakefulness to rest. Consistency matters more than intensity: going to bed and waking up at roughly the same times every day trains the circadian system to anticipate rest, making mornings feel clearer and afternoons more manageable. Another important facet is the sleep environment itself. A cool, quiet, and dark room supports deeper sleep, while comfortable bedding and minimal noise disruptions foster uninterrupted rest. It is also beneficial to use the bed solely for sleep and intimacy rather than work, which strengthens the brain’s association between the bed and restorative states. By investing in these small environmental and behavioral changes, the brain’s capacity for sustained attention increases, which has a direct and lasting impact on motivation and executive functioning during waking hours.
Beyond duration, sleep quality matters. Deep sleep and REM sleep contribute to memory consolidation, emotional regulation, and creative problem solving. Maintaining consistent meal patterns and avoiding heavy meals close to bedtime can reduce nighttime awakenings and support a more continuous sleep cycle. Gentle stretching, breathing exercises, or brief mindfulness practices can ease the transition to sleep and prime the body for restorative rest. Conversely, chronic sleep debt creates a vulnerability to stress and a vulnerability to distracting thoughts that hijack attention. Restorative sleep, in contrast, acts like a recharging station, smoothing the tumult of daytime tasks and enabling a person to approach challenges with clearer thinking and a more resilient mood. Embracing sleep as a non negotiable cornerstone shifts the entire calculus of motivation and mental energy toward sustainable vitality.
Finally, naps can be a useful tool when structured appropriately, especially for individuals with demanding schedules. Short, controlled naps can improve alertness and mood without significantly disrupting nighttime sleep if timed strategically. The key is to keep naps moderate in length and to schedule them earlier in the day rather than late afternoon or evening. When used thoughtfully, naps are not a sign of weakness but an adaptive strategy to maintain peak cognitive readiness. Integrating attentive sleep habits with daytime routines creates a reliable engine for motivation, making it easier to initiate tasks, maintain focus, and recover quickly when fatigue arises. In this way, sleep becomes not a passive background process but an active, intentional practice that continuously energizes the mind and clears the path for sustained effort.
Nutrition, Hydration, and Brain Fuel
What we eat and drink shapes the brain’s ability to stay alert, flexible, and resilient. Proper nutrition provides the raw materials for neurotransmitters, supports cellular health, and stabilizes blood sugar to prevent energy crashes. The brain, while small in mass, consumes a significant share of daily energy, so the foods chosen have outsized effects on cognitive performance and motivation. A balanced approach emphasizes whole foods, varied nutrients, and gradual nourishment rather than drastic dieting. When meals are consistent and nutrient-dense, the brain experiences steadier energy, fewer fluctuations in mood, and improved capacity for planning and decision making. This creates a favorable context for motivation to arise and remain steady across the day.
Hydration is a simple but often overlooked factor. Even mild dehydration can impair attention, short term memory, and reaction times, while clarity of thinking benefits from steady availability of fluids. A practical habit is to drink water regularly throughout the day and to be mindful of thirst as a cue for replenishment. Beyond water, certain nutrients play specific roles in supporting mental energy. Carbohydrates provide the brain with glucose, the fuel that powers thinking, but choosing complex carbohydrates with fiber helps prevent sharp spikes and crashes. Protein supports neurotransmitter production, while healthy fats from sources like fish, nuts, seeds, and olive oil contribute to structural brain health and signaling efficiency. Micronutrients such as iron, zinc, magnesium, and B vitamins are involved in energy metabolism and concentration, so a diverse plate helps ensure these systems remain resilient. It is not necessary to chase perfect nutrition; instead, aim for consistency, mindful portions, and regular meals that sustain cognitive stamina.
In addition to macro and micronutrients, consider the role of patterns and timing. Eating small, balanced meals at regular intervals can avert frequently dipping energy and the accompanying loss of motivation. Mindful eating supports awareness of fullness cues and prevents the discomfort that can sap attention. Limiting highly processed foods, added sugars, and excessive caffeine late in the day helps stabilize sleep and mood, which in turn preserves daytime motivation. Caffeine can be a useful cognitive amplifier when used strategically, but relying on it to compensate for sleep loss or daily energy deficits often produces diminishing returns. When caffeine is used, pairing it with meals, avoiding late afternoon intake, and listening to the body’s signals helps preserve a clean energy signal that supports purposeful action rather than jittery, unsustainable bursts. Nutrition thus acts as a practical lever that either fuels or drains motivation depending on how it is managed across weeks and months.
Ultimately, the aim is a daily nourishment plan that respects personal preferences and schedules while prioritizing reliability and balance. Food and fluids become tools that the brain can use to maintain focus, tolerate stress, and translate intention into consistent behavior. When nutrition aligns with sleep and movement, motivation gains a stable baseline. The result is not a dramatic one time boost but a smooth, enduring elevation of mental energy that makes it possible to carry projects from idea to completion with less friction and greater satisfaction.
Movement, Exercise, and the Brain’s Energy Economy
Physical activity is one of the most effective catalysts for motivation, mood regulation, and cognitive sharpness. Movement triggers a cascade of neurochemical events that sharpen attention, enhance creativity, and strengthen resilience against fatigue. Even modest levels of activity, when integrated into daily life, can yield meaningful improvements in mental energy. The emotional and cognitive benefits of movement are not limited to athletes; they extend to people with diverse schedules, responsibilities, and preferences. The key is to view exercise not as a punishment or a chore but as a co pilot for clearer thinking, steadier motivation, and a more peaceful relationship with effort.
Consistency matters more than intensity. A gentle, regular routine that becomes a habit often delivers better long term benefits than sporadic, intense workouts that exhaust and disrupt daily balance. Start with approachable moves that fit into daily life: short walks, light stretching, simple bodyweight exercises, or a cycling commute. As stamina grows, gently expand with slightly longer sessions or a mix of endurance, strength, and mobility work. The brain loves predicted structure, and predictable activity schedules reduce cognitive load by turning exertion into a reflex rather than a decision. This predictability reduces the cognitive overhead associated with starting tasks, freeing mental energy for higher level planning and creative thought—both of which reinforce motivation.
Movement also improves sleep quality and stress processing. Morning movement can help anchor the day and synchronize circadian rhythms, while movement after periods of sedentary work can prevent afternoon slumps. The cardiovascular and muscular adaptations from regular activity translate into steadier energy delivery to the brain, supporting disciplined focus and steady progress toward goals. Importantly, the quality of movement matters as well. Mindful exercise that emphasizes breathing, posture, and technique reduces the likelihood of injury and fatigue while enhancing the sense of control and mastery. This sense of mastery itself feeds motivation, creating a virtuous loop in which physical health and mental engagement reinforce each other.
As with sleep and nutrition, the goal is sustainable integration rather than a dramatic revolution. Small daily improvements accumulate into a robust energetic profile that supports sustained attention, better decision making, and more resilient mood. When people experience the positive sensations of movement—clearer thinking, lighter steps, steadier energy—they begin to associate activity with rewards rather than punishment, further fueling motivation to continue. Movement, in this view, becomes a trusted ally in the ongoing work of maintaining mental energy and purposeful action.

Habit Formation and the Power of Micro-Consistency
Habits are powerful containers for motivation and energy because they convert deliberate actions into automatic routines. When a behavior becomes habitual, it requires less cognitive effort to initiate, which conserves mental energy for higher level tasks. Yet the creation of durable habits requires intention, patience, and careful design. Rather than attempting to overhaul a life overnight, a series of small, repeatable changes can accumulate into lasting improvements. The most effective habit designs consider cues, routines, and rewards, constructing a pattern that becomes familiar and reliable over time. Cues might be a specific time of day, a location, or an emotional state that reliably precedes a desired action. The routine is the activity itself, performed with consistency. The reward consolidates the habit, ensuring that the brain associates the behavior with a positive outcome and is therefore inclined to repeat it.
When introducing new habits, it is beneficial to start with one or two that align with broad goals and easily integrate into daily life. The success of these initial changes then creates a sense of competence and momentum that makes it easier to adopt additional habits later. The focus should be on gradual improvement, not perfection. Even when a habit falters, returning to the cue and the routine as soon as possible preserves the overall trajectory and prevents a single lapse from derailing long term progress. In this way, habit formation becomes a practical engine for maintaining motivation, because consistent, modest actions accumulate into a substantial transformation over time. The brain learns that steady effort yields predictable results, and that understanding tends to increase both energy and enthusiasm for continued work.
Beyond personal habits, it is also useful to consider environmental habits that support motivation. Behavioral nudges, such as placing necessary tools within easy reach, scheduling recurring reminders, or creating lightweight prework rituals, can reduce the cognitive burden of starting tasks. When the environment reinforces positive behaviors, the likelihood of action increases, which in turn sustains motivation through repeated success. In practice, this means designing daily micro rituals that are simple to perform, quick to complete, and clearly aligned with bigger ambitions. The cumulative effect is a resilience of energy and a more persistent sense that purposeful work is attainable and enjoyable.
Ultimately, habit formation is about choosing to invest over time in patterns that accumulate value. It is the quiet, steady practice of small acts that, over weeks and months, yields a transformed capacity for motivation and mental energy. By embracing the concept of micro-consistency, a person can progress even on days when inspiration is elusive, knowing that consistent action will eventually create the conditions for excitement, engagement, and genuine momentum.
